Bangladesh Retracts Port Deal Amid Intensified Protests Ahead of Election
•
Bangladesh has withdrawn its plan to lease a major container terminal at Chattogram to a foreign operator.
•
The decision follows intensified protests and an indefinite shutdown by dockers ahead of the February 12 election.
•
The deal, involving the New Mooring Container Terminal (NCT) and Dubai-based DP World, was nearing its final stage.
•
Officials stated that discussions would likely continue under the next government after the election.
•
The NCT handles 40% of Bangladesh's international trade, and the strike severely disrupted vessel movements.
